    The Organic Council of Ontario (French: Conseil Biologique de l'Ontario) is a non-profit membership based association based in Guelph, Ontario in Canada.. The association represents the Organic farming sector in Ontario at the national and provincial level.

    Organic Meadow Cooperative is an agricultural cooperative in Ontario. The cooperative originated in 1989 after local farmers sitting around a kitchen table realized that commercialized farming practices were not sustainable for them.

    According to the annual Dairy Farm Accounting Project report, Ontario dairy farmers saw their net farm profit drop from Can$178,601 in 2012 to Can$90,114 in 2016, [95] the lowest point since 2006. [96] The June 2018 report, showed that the net farm income in 2017 was Can$128,230, the first increase since 2012.

    Organic farming is practiced around the globe, but the markets for sale are strongest in North America and Europe, while the greatest dedicated area is accounted for by Australia, the greatest number of producers are in India, and the Falkland Islands record the highest share of agricultural land dedicated to organic production.
